Dr. O'Connor is a Board Certified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(D.O.), and is fully trained to treat the whole person, seeking to cure the cause of diseases, not just the results or symptoms of the disease.
Dr. O'Connor has been practicing in the Oklahoma City area since 1987. Her main focus is on family care, minor emergency, and sports medicine. She has been a team physician for Golden Gloves, Special Olympics and the Oklahoma City Warriors Soccer Team.
Dr. O'Connor studied medicine at Oklahoma State University College of Osteopathic Medicine. She obtained her undergraduate degree in Physical Therapy at the University of Oklahoma and her Master's at the University of Minnesota.
